Indian-inspired Tandoori Chicken Quesadillas with Raita Dip

Discover a delicious fusion dish that combines the bold flavors of India with the comforting appeal of quesadillas. Indian-inspired Tandoori Chicken Quesadillas with Raita Dip offer a perfect blend of spicy, creamy, and crispy textures that are sure to impress your family and guests.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• 2 tablespoons tandoori masala spice mix
  • 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 1 cucumber, grated
  • 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
  • 4 large flour tortillas
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• Fresh cilantro for garnish

Preparation of Tandoori Chicken

Start by marinating the shredded chicken with the tandoori masala and a tablespoon of yogurt. Let it sit for at least 30 minutes to absorb the flavors. This step enhances the authenticity of the dish and ensures a rich, spicy taste.

Making the Raita Dip

In a bowl, combine the remaining yogurt with grated cucumber and a pinch of salt. Mix well and garnish with chopped cilantro. This cooling raita balances the spices of the chicken and adds a refreshing element to the dish.

Assembling and Cooking the Quesadillas

Heat a skillet over medium heat and add a little oil. Place a tortilla on the skillet, sprinkle with cheese, and evenly distribute the marinated chicken over half of the tortilla. Fold the tortilla in half and cook until golden brown and crispy, about 3-4 minutes per side. Repeat with remaining tortillas.

Serving Suggestions

Slice the quesadillas into wedges and serve hot with a side of cool raita dip. Garnish with fresh cilantro for an extra burst of flavor. This dish pairs well with a simple salad or steamed vegetables for a complete meal.
